Just curious, looking at the possibility of a Vauxhall Ampera, wondering how the Internal Combustion engine acts in relation to the all electric side. Assuming fully charged, and attempting to use on a daily basis on all-electric. Does the IC not start at all, even from the outset ? does it only fire up if extra power is required or if the battery is depleted ? that being the case, how does it generate temperature to warm the oil ? surely it doesn't wait, stone cold for you to mash your foot on an overtake ?
I tried a Yaris hybrid some time ago, obviously a more limited electric range, but as I remember, it would start the IC and run for until it had warmed a bit before it would allow the Electric motor.

The ice is a range extender, it doesn’t drive the car at all.

It’s very different from a hybrid. The Ampera can only be driven on the electric motor, when the battery runs out the ice kicks in acting as a generator to put energy back into the battery.
